This is a turistic place located in the municipality of Zunil, Quetzaltenango, the cost is Q30.00 per person plus Q20.00 for parking. The main characteristic of this place is the thermal and medicinal pool, because the water comes from the Zunil Volcano. It is a nice place, especially if you go to the pools at the bottom, however to visit this area in which children are not allowed. To get into this area you need to pay additional Q25.00 quetzales. Exchange rate Q7.50 per Us$1.00

You are going to love the road to get here, it's amazing. The place is really good, it has 3 pool with naturally warm water, at different temperatures each. Restaurant, locker service, bungalows(if you want to stay) and they even say the water has healing powers.
